Biography

Early life on Valruudd

At a very young age, Licah Fox already had a penchant for hacking authorities' computers. At the age of eight, he managed to override the boot process of all of his school's computers with an infinite loop of the Valruudd national anthem. His flair for the theatrical showed itself at the moment when he walked into the administration's office just after he rebooted every computer. Nearly kicked out of school, he only received reinstatement after testaments on his behalf from his parents and a local bartender named Snappleguy who served him Snapples several days a week.

As a teenager, Licah explored the distant recesses of the HoloNet in an attempt to learn more about the universe. Deep into a message board devoted to starfighter combat tips, he came across an advertisement by Juho Taskinen for the Rebel Squadrons. Though in admiration of the autonomous frontier style of the RS, Licah gave it little further thought until he happened to run into Snappleguy at a local bar a couple of years later. He hadn't seen Snap for almost four years, and asked him where he'd gone. To Licah's surprise, Snap had spent his time commanding a squadron and even a wing of the Rebel Squadrons. Licah always remembered Snap's words afterwards: "It'd suit you, Licah. That little stunt you pulled at school a long time ago? They'd recognize your talent and give you important work to do." Along with Snap's stories of the flying ability of his squadmates, Licah suddenly felt a strong urge to get off his planet for the first time and join the Rebel Squadrons.

First assignment: FireClaw Squadron

Upon arrival at the Academy, Licah received an assignment to share a bunk bed with Dev Azzameen, a fateful pairing of pilots that would continue for many years and induce terror into enemies' hearts. After they both completed their training with distinction, they received a transfer to FireClaw Squadron under the command of Menshk Vrei'Sik. After getting used to the pace of the Patriot Battle Fleet, Licah and Dev soon put FireClaw on the map. When Menshk received a promotion to Wing CO, Licah took over command of FireClaw and turned it into the cream of the crop in the PBF. For an entire year, FireClaw pilots continually destroyed more Imperial ships than those of any other squadron, and led all twelve squadrons on the leaderboard. Licah convinced Snappleguy and Nefo T'chir to rejoin squadron stalwarts such as Jairo Pantoja and Jack "Blazer" Barnes, amongst others. Even Kirghy Lommax flew with the squadron at its height. Knowledge of FireClaw's fabled history, including stints as CO by Jack Stewart and Mike "MacMan" McEwen, kept Licah motivated to make FireClaw the very best of the Rebel Squadrons.

Special Operations: Ace Pilot

As Licah's time in service grew, he received many requests from command to assist with special operations elsewhere on the frontier. Befriending ace pilot Han Suul and brainstormer Adam "Vender" Fene, Licah began to spend his off-duty time exploring the history of the RS and the problems it currently faced, and pondering with the others how to solve them through targeted missions with ad hoc squadrons. Licah eventually made the decision to leave his full-time position in FireClaw and fly missions with Skull Squadron, Jedi Squadron, Red Dragon Squadron, Stinger Squadron, Phantom Squadron, among many others. He developed a reputation as one of the top five pilots in the Rebel Squadrons, able to complete any mission with a remote probability of success.

Hacking the Command Staff

After almost two years of service, Licah had grown dissatisfied with always taking orders from the top brass, even when the leadership seemed unable to divine the necessary actions that seemed obvious to him. He used his computer expertise already displayed on Valruudd to gradually hack into the RS's mainframe, and eventually gained access to the very core of the database, including all internal messages beyond the official communiques, and the ability to mimic the identity of any officer. He kept his abilities under wraps until a particularly frustrating moment, when due to his access, he saw that the RSXO had falsified documents relating to his performance in previous missions. Immediately filing a grievance about it without any thought of consequences, but only out of a sense of righteousness, the top command staff quickly discovered Licah's illicit activities and not only dismissed his case against the RSXO, but FC Rahj Tharen very nearly expelled him from the RS with a dishonorable discharge. Only the private appeal of Dave Trebonious-Astoris, who saw Licah's potential, kept his career alive. Rahj, with misgivings, decided to take Dave's advice, and appointed Licah as provisional RS Internet Officer, which had largely lain vacant since the departure of Shikkie Kaaran many years earlier. The special skillset required for the job, along with its high-pressure nature, had meant the total absence of anyone qualified and willing to fill the position properly. Embracing his new set of tasks, Licah set about updating the whole communications network of the Rebel Squadrons, a task which would take him many years.

Appearance and personality

Licah is descended paternally from the Vulpes species, and as the only member of that species serving in the RS, all officers immediately recognize him due to his fox-like humanoid appearance. Due to copious shedding during the stress of battle, his personal fighters have a special filtration system to ensure clean air.

For most of his life, Licah had the easygoing, relaxed attitude of a creature who knew he could match any rival in combat or intellectual wit, took all assignments with aplomb, and especially enjoyed the hardest tasksthat few accepted. Towards recent years, however, the pressure and responsibilities of long years of difficult leadership have made Licah much more serious, and an extensive list of lost squadmates has kept Licah from stepping into the cockpit except in cases of sore need. The loss of so many good officers in Command also has placed a heavy burden on Licah. He and Joshua Hawkins alone share the responsibilities of maintaining the HoloNet, with a list of duties that remains the same as in years past, but without the help of dozens of other officers.
